    1. Can You Finance Your College Education with An Unsecured Loan? Many college students seek out Federal Student Loans to enjoy lower interest rates and easier repayment. However, there are certain standards about Federal Student Loans and those who don’t qualify may need to apply for a student loan from private lenders. Since most student loans are unsecured, let’s discuss the factors that lending companies consider before granting approval. How much do you need to loan? Financing a four-year degree course may require a rather high loan value. Most lending companies that offer unsecured student loans may extend only a limited amount of financing. Because of the risk involved, these lenders do not provide instant approval for higher loan values. This is why some students apply for multiple loans from different lenders to ensure that their college education financing is covered all throughout. Even those who qualify for subsidized federal student loans may still apply for an unsecured loan from a private lender. The money loaned will serve as back-up for other school expenses until they graduate from college. Seriously ponder how much loan you really need to support your education. Do not apply for a bigger loan just to enjoy a higher allowance each month. Remember that with every penny you spend from your loan, you will need to pay off on your college graduation. Save your money for more important things. As much as possible, try to pay off even just the interest rate of your student loan so that at least a portion of your debts can be eliminated while you’re still in school. Is your credit qualified? Unsecured loans will require a good or excellent credit score. Take note that this type of student loan doesn’t require the submission of collateral. To make up for the risk, lenders only grant approvals for customers who show an impressive credit history. Nevertheless, you may still get higher interest rates despite your credit advantage. Because it is an unsecured student loan, you can expect that the rates and fees would be higher than that of secured loans. Of course, this doesn’t mean you should settle with unreasonable terms and conditions. As a student, you must also take time comparing private student loan lenders to see which company offers the most reasonable deal. Do you have a stable income? To get approved, you will be required to submit proofs of your income stability. Proofs may include a copy of your payslips and tax presentations. In a student’s case, you may need to get a cosigner for your loan. Many lending companies will limit your loan amount to 45% of the monthly income. The reason is because lenders want to ensure that you will be capable of your monthly repayment despite having other duties to other creditors or lenders. These are the three main factors that Private Student Loan lenders consider when reviewing your application. Before submitting an application to your chosen lender, it would be wise to weigh your chances of getting approved.
